Abstract

The CrAg LFA is recommended for use with serum, plasma or CSF for diagnosis of cryptococcal meningitis or non-meningeal cryptococcal disease in symptomatic patients. There is a need for further evaluation of LFA for screening of asymptomatic patients. However, the LFA is emerging as a valuable tool for screening of serum or plasma in ART-naive adults with CD4 counts less than 100 cells/mm(3) in geographic regions with a high prevalence of cryptococcal antigenemia. CrAg screening has the potential to identify patients with asymptomatic cryptococcal infection who should receive preemptive antifungal therapy.
